The cheapest way to get from Kemaman (Station) to Singapore is to bus and train which costs $17 - $30 and takes 8h 9m.
The fastest way to get from Kemaman (Station) to Singapore is to taxi and fly which takes 2h 36m and costs $140 - $320.
No, there is no direct bus from Kemaman (Station) to Singapore. However, there are services departing from Kemaman and arriving at Queen Street Terminal via Bus Terminal Segamat, Larkin Ter and JB Custom IN.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 9h 53m.
The distance between Kemaman (Station) and Singapore is 367 km. The road distance is 402 km.
The best way to get from Kemaman (Station) to Singapore without a car is to bus and train which takes 8h 9m and costs $17 - $30.
It takes approximately 2h 36m to get from Kemaman (Station) to Singapore, including transfers.
